Frequently Asked Questions
Is the sort case-sensitive?
No. “apple” and “Apple” are treated as equal, so the result matches what most people expect from an alphabetical list.
What happens to empty lines?
They are moved to the top of the sorted list. Combine this tool with Remove Duplicate Lines to clean up a messy list completely.
Is my text safe when I use this tool?
Yes. The sorting runs entirely in your browser with JavaScript. Your text is never sent to a server, never stored and never logged.
